TikTok: Capturing Attention with Creativity

TikTok's algorithm is designed to promote content based on engagement rather than follower count, making it a fertile ground for rapid growth. Here are some strategies:

  • Leverage Trends: Participate in trending challenges or use popular sounds to increase your content's discoverability.
  • Tell a Story: Use TikTok’s format to create engaging narratives that resonate with your audience.
  • Collaborate with Influencers: Partnering with TikTok influencers can expose your brand to wider audiences quickly.

Key Metrics to Track

When using platforms like Instagram and TikTok, keep an eye on the following metrics to gauge your success:

  • Engagement Rate: This includes likes, comments, shares, and saves.
  • Follower Growth: Track your follower count to ensure your strategies are effective.
  • Content Reach: Monitor how far your posts are spreading beyond your existing follower base.
